Louis Vuitton's Rigorous Diamond Assessment: The Four Cs
Before delving into specific pieces, it’s crucial to understand Louis Vuitton’s approach to diamond selection. The brand adheres to the universally recognized “four Cs” – carat, color, clarity, and cut – to assess the quality of each diamond. This rigorous evaluation ensures that only the finest stones grace their collections.
* Carat: This refers to the weight of the diamond, and consequently, its size. Larger carats generally command higher prices, but the overall quality determined by the other Cs remains paramount. Louis Vuitton carefully selects diamonds with optimal carat weights for each piece, balancing size with the overall aesthetic design.
* Color: The color grading scale assesses how colorless a diamond is. Diamonds with minimal color (ranging from D, the highest grade, to Z, the lowest) are considered more valuable. Louis Vuitton prioritizes diamonds with exceptional color, aiming for stones that exhibit maximum brilliance and sparkle.
* Clarity: This refers to the presence of inclusions (internal flaws) and blemishes (external flaws) in the diamond. Fewer imperfections mean higher clarity and, consequently, higher value. Louis Vuitton's meticulous selection process ensures that only diamonds with minimal inclusions and blemishes make the cut.
* Cut: The cut of a diamond significantly impacts its brilliance, fire, and scintillation. A well-cut diamond maximizes the reflection and refraction of light, creating a dazzling sparkle. Louis Vuitton employs expert gemologists to select diamonds with exceptional cuts, ensuring that every stone showcases its inherent beauty to its fullest potential.
These four Cs, evaluated holistically, provide a comprehensive picture of a diamond’s unique nature and value. Louis Vuitton’s commitment to these standards underpins the quality and prestige of its growing diamond collection.
